研究概览
简要总结
In type 2 diabetic patients with poor glycemic control despite maximum "classic" oral treatment, bed time insulin therapy may lead to a parallel increase in abdominal visceral and subcutaneous fat, whereas pioglitazone treatment should lead to a stability (or even a decrease ) in visceral and an increase in subcutaneous abdominal fat. As visceral fat mass is correlated with insulin-resistance and cardio-vascular risk, the evolution of visceral abdominal fat in type 2 diabetic patients is of great importance.
Main objective:
To compare visceral and subcutaneous abdominal fat compartment after a six-month bed time insulin or pioglitazone treatment in type 2 diabetic patients with poor glycemic control despite a maximal oral treatment with metformin and sulfonylureas.

入选标准
- •Type 2 diabetes
- •BMI= 26kg/m2
- •Maximal treatment with metformin and sulfonylurea
- •HbA1c between 7.5 and 9.5%
排除标准
- •Anterior treatment with glitazones
- •Anterior treatment with insulin
- •Known heart failure
- •Hepatopathy
- •Renal filtration less than 60ml/min, Hb<10g/dl
- •Corticoids treatment
